Trump says US, N. Korea ‘negotiating’ on location for next Kim summit

US President Donald Trump says negotiations are underway on the location of the next summit with North Korean leader Kim Jong Un.

Trump, who held a historic summit with Kim in Singapore in June, said last week that he received a “great letter” from the North Korean leader but declined to reveal its contents.

“We are negotiating a location,” he tells reporters before boarding a helicopter for the presidential retreat at Camp David, Maryland, where he says he will be discussing a trade deal with China.

The letter from Kim came after he warned in a New Year’s speech that Pyongyang may change its approach to nuclear talks if Washington persists with sanctions.

Trump insists, however, that “with North Korea, we have a very good dialogue.”
